Initially, the board had planned to relocate the remaining matches to Dubai due to mounting security concerns. However, just 24 hours later, the decision was reversed after increasing military tensions along the Line of Control (LoC) and a series of drone incursions.

The remaining eight fixtures of the PSL, originally set to be played in Rawalpindi, Multan, and Lahore, were supposed to bring top-class cricket to Pakistani stadiums, with players like Babar Azam, Shaheen Afridi, and Mohammad Rizwan captivating the hearts of millions. However, concerns over player safety and national security led the PCB to make a difficult but necessary decision.

The Escalating Security Situation

The shift of the PSL matches was initially a response to the growing security threats, particularly the missile and drone strikes launched from India, which have heightened tensions in the region. One of these drones even crashed near the Rawalpindi International Cricket Stadium, leading to the suspension of a match between Peshawar Zalmi and Karachi Kings. The escalating situation, including the death of 26 innocent civilians in the Pahalgam terror attack on April 22, made the PCB reevaluate its stance.

On the advice of Prime Minister Shahbaz Sharif, the PCB announced the indefinite postponement of the remaining PSL fixtures, putting the safety of players and fans at the forefront. This decision, while hard-hitting for fans who were eagerly awaiting live-action in Pakistan, emphasizes the importance of national unity and security in such uncertain times.

Foreign Player Concerns and the Mental Well-being of Players

Another factor contributing to the postponement was the rising concerns among foreign players, some of whom had already expressed reluctance to continue playing in the volatile security environment. The PCB addressed these concerns by assuring the safety of all participants, acknowledging the mental strain that the situation has placed on players from both Pakistan and abroad.
